NCT ID: NCT01239602 Recruiting - Stroke Clinical Trials

The Variation of Movement Related Cortical Potential, Cortico-cortical Inhibition, and Motor Evoked Potential in Intracerebral Implantation of Antologous Peripheral Blood Stem Cells(CD34)in Old Ischemic Stroke

Start date: October 2010
Phase: N/A
Study type: Observational

Stem cell theray in old stroke patients is a study to treat stroke patients approved before in our hospital. We recruit these patients who received stem cell therapy and completed the study. We adopted movement-related cortical potential,and cortico-cortical inhibition to assess the stroke patients with or without stem cell therapy. Further analyzing the correlation of the motor related cortical potential and cortico-cortical inhibition among them. We wanted to find out if there are changes in cortical excitability in subjects with chronic stroke after stem cell therapy.

NCT ID: NCT01225562 Completed - Stroke Clinical Trials

Prevention of Cardiovascular Events (eg, Death From Heart or Vascular Disease, Heart Attack, or Stroke) in Patients With Prior Heart Attack Using Ticagrelor Compared to Placebo on a Background of Aspirin

PEGASUS
Start date: October 2010
Phase: Phase 3
Study type: Interventional

This study is being carried out to see if a new drug called ticagrelor given twice daily in addition to the ASA therapy decreases the frequency of cardiovascular events (e.g., death from heart disease, heart attack, or stroke).

NCT ID: NCT01221246 Completed - Stroke Clinical Trials

Efficacy and Safety Study of GM602 in Patients With Acute Middle Cerebral Artery Ischemic Stroke Within 18 Hours

GMAIS
Start date: March 8, 2011
Phase: Phase 2
Study type: Interventional

The purpose of this research study is to determine whether the investigational drug GM602, is effective and safe in the treatment of ischemic stroke (strokes caused by a blood clot blocking the flow of blood through one, or more of the blood vessels supplying the brain) when administered up to 18 hours after symptoms begin.
